Kenyan security officials have asked citizens to be on alert for possible terrorist attacks after the al-Shabaab-affiliated Muslim Youth Centre (MYC) vowed to retaliate when allied forces
liberated Kismayo. "The time of public warnings via Twitter or other social media is now a thing of the past," MYC said in a press statement.
"MYC inKenyaand our mujahideen brothers in the region are preparing for any eventualities that may transpire in Kismayo,
and with the grace of Allah respond accordingly and decisively." - More
